36 China Town (2006)
5/10
More comedy than a thriller
4 June 2006
This movie is a typical bollywood film, keep your thinking caps at home and you can enjoy the movie thoroughly. The first half an hour drags on with 3 (!!) songs, but after that the things pick up. In fact all the scenes seem to have been stretched to give the film its running time. Akshaye Khanna makes an entry just after the interval. Now if the film followed the logical rules of life, it should have ended after half an hour from the interval. But all the suspects lie like kindergarten kids and complicate the matter. Even after all this there is hardly any suspense at all. But the ample comedy, good songs and Upen Patel makes up for all this. Upen Patel's performance deserves a mention, he really exudes that cool persona. Rest all are usual. So all in all its a good enough time pass, provided one is not paying the multiplex prices.

Aankhen (1993)
7/10
Brainless and fun
12 October 2005
This movie is a typical David Dhawan fare. Be sure to turn off your brains while watching the movie. After that well the movie is pretty enjoyable and the gags are rather effective. Chunkey and Govinda are in a double role; as a result comedy of errors follows and hence laughter ensues. The supporting cast also fits in to the fullest. Kader Khan is at his best. The villains are pretty much dirtiest type a comedy can have and are rather menacing. Overall its a fun filled 3 hours ride, I would recommend it to anyone who can digest and enjoy Govinda-David Dhawan brand of humour. And yes look out for the monkey who's the third most important member of the cast.
